Welcome to the Four Hundred Twenty Seventh episode of Daily Daf Differently. In this episode, Rabbi David Wise looks at Masechet Yoma Daf 27.


What may a zar, a non-kohen, do to participate in the sacrificial service? And how does the Gemara respond to blatant rabbinic brain cramps?


David Wise has been rabbi of the Hollis Hills Jewish Center in Queens, NY since 2005. Before that, he led Temple Beth El in Somerset, NJ. Ordained at JTS in1996, he is proudly married to Judy Krinitz and is the father of two teens. And then there’s that thing he has for the Toronto Maple Leafs…
